To triumph in day trading necessitates more than mere comprehension of intricate charts and financial reports. It requires opting for an optimal trading approach complementing your risk inclination, personality, and profit objectives.

Please keep in mind that not all present trading strategies are apt for day trading. Day trading is a unique brand of trading that necessitates swift decision-making and a thorough comprehension of market shifts.

While it is true that every day comes with its own unique trading opportunities, it takes a skilled, experienced, and disciplined trader to identify these chances and grab them with both hands.

While trading, establishing a trading plan that outlines your market tactics, risk management safeguards, and review mechanism is crucial. Most victorious traders highly regard their trading plans and deem them essential tools for day trading.

Additionally, day trading demands adept technical analysis skills, crucial for interpreting market trends and cues. A firm familiarity with trading tools and software also plays a significant role in your journey to becoming a successful day trader.

Patience and a cool demeanour are other attributes that cannot be underestimated. Day trading is not about earning fast money, but about making sound trade decisions.

It's normal to observe budding traders who get excessively engrossed with the technical aspects of day trading, missing out on the broader goal of deriving profitable trades. The proficient day traders understand that they don't need to win every trade, but instead they should win a greater number of trades over an extended period.
